uzuki‐type coupling reactions can be performed directly in air using a catalytic system composed of iodine, potassium carbonate, and polyethylene glycol 400 (I 2 /K 2 CO 3 /PEG‐400). Iodine was found to be an effective additive for accelerating these couplings. The methodology is also suitable for the coupling of ( E )‐ β ‐bromostyene with phenylboronic acid, with retention of the double bond geometry.
